Result: Sieve Fraction (<100¿m):

weighted sample: 0,9832 g

weight fraction <100 ¿m: 0,0316 g

mass fraction <100 ¿m: 3,21 %

Result: Particle Size Distribution for sieve fraction nominal < 100 µm

99.43%: 5 - 100 µm

0.57%: > 100 µm

Statistical Data:

 Counts  1051  
   Mean diameter [¿m]  Aspect Ratio
 Minimum  16.11  1.05
 Maximum  104.05  8.93
Arithmetic mean  47.84  1.57 
 Median  43.81  1.48
 Standard deviation  19.51  0.44

Result: Mass Fraction (calculated) for sieve fraction nominal < 100 µm:

100%: 10 - 100 µm (inhalable)

 Particle Size  Spherical Volume [%]  Cubical Volume [%]
 <4 ¿m (respirable) 0.0 0.0 
 4-10 ¿m (thoracic) 0.0  0.0
 10-100 ¿m (inhalable) 100.0 100.0
 >100 ¿m 0.0 0.0 
 Median (diameter ¿m)  73.45  74.36

Conclusion:

 Accounting based on the total sample weight    
   Particle Size [¿m]  Spherical Volume [%]
 Mass Fraction  >100  96.79
 Sieve Fraction  >100  0.0
 Total (>100¿m)    96.79
 Sieve Fraction  10-100 (inhalable)  3.21
 Sieve Fraction  4-10 (thoracic)  0.0
 Sieve Fraction  <4 (respirable)  0.0
Conclusions:
The MMAD (Mass Median Aerodynamic Diameter < 100µm) of the substance has a value of 73.45 µm as spherical particles.
